Justin Houseknecht is a Professor of Chemistry and Chair of the Department of Chemistry at Wittenberg University, OH (2018–present). He specializes in organic chemistry with a focus on computational methods, nucleophilic acyl substitution mechanisms, and evidence-based pedagogy. His research spans reaction mechanisms, textbook analysis, and educational reform.
- Ph.D. in Chemistry, The Ohio State University (2003)
- B.S. in Biochemistry, Grove City College (1998)
His research interests include:
- Computational studies of organic reaction mechanisms (associative/dissociative pathways).
- Development of active learning pedagogies in organic chemistry.
- Analysis of organic chemistry textbook content evolution.
- Integration of technology (e.g., iPads, hybrid teaching) for collaborative learning.
Publications and presentations highlight his work on specification grading, workshop-based faculty development, and conformational studies of carbohydrates and heterocycles. He has collaborated extensively with students on computational chemistry projects and educational research.
